Description
This casserole combines tender chicken, savory ham, creamy sauce, melted Swiss cheese, and a golden Stove Top stuffing topping into an easy weeknight dinner that delights the whole family.

Instructions
1. Preheat oven to 375°F and grease a 9×13-inch baking dish.
2. In a bowl whisk together cream of chicken soup, sour cream, milk, Dijon mustard,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
3. Toss cooked chicken and ham with the creamy sauce until evenly coated.
4. Spread the chicken mixture in the prepared baking dish and smooth the top.
5. Sprinkle Swiss cheese and Parmesan evenly over the chicken mixture.
6. Prepare stuffing by combining stuffing mix with melted butter and hot chicken broth; let stand until moistened.
7. Fluff the stuffing and spread it evenly over the cheese layer.
8. Cover with foil and bake for 20 minutes, then remove foil and bake uncovered for 10–15 minutes until stuffing is golden and casserole is bubbly.
9. Let rest for 5–10 minutes before serving.
- Prep Time: 20 minutes
- Cook Time: 35 minutes
